Relatório de Ponto,

Delphi

19/12/2011

Olá amigos,

Tenho o seguinte banco de dados..

Funcionarios
Id
Nome
Setor

Ponto
data
hora
id_func

Gostaria de saber como faco para montar um relatório que me mostre o seguinte(SQL/Delphi).:

Entre 01/01/2011 e 30/01/2011
Funcionario.: Antonio de Andrade de souza

Data | Hora Entrada | Hora Saida | Hora Entrada | Hora Saida | Total trabalhado


Desde já agradeço.....
Kleber Silva

Kleber Silva

Curtidas 0

Respostas

Leonardo Xavier

Leonardo Xavier

19/12/2011

os seus campos data e hora são que tipo de dados?
GOSTEI 0
Kleber Silva

Kleber Silva

19/12/2011

os seus campos data e hora são que tipo de dados?


data - date
hota - time
GOSTEI 0
Leonardo Xavier

Leonardo Xavier

19/12/2011

Tente isto.
DM.Query_Geral.Close;
      DM.Query_Geral.CommandText := Select * from GERAL Where DATA_FATURA >= :D1 and DATA_FATURA <= :D2 
and data=d1 and data<d2;
      DM.Query_Geral.ParamByName(D1).AsSQLTimeStamp := DateTimeToSQLTimeStamp (D1);
      DM.Query_Geral.ParamByName(D2).AsSQLTimeStamp := DateTimeToSQLTimeStamp (D2);
      DM.Query_Geral.Open;
GOSTEI 0
POSTAR